Professional Background

Daniel Morris is a distinguished professional with a robust background in finance and industrial relations. Currently, he serves as the Finance Lead at WeWork, where he leverages his expertise to enhance financial operations and strategic planning within the organization. With a foundation in labor and industrial relations, Daniel applies a unique perspective that combines financial acumen with insights into workforce dynamics, contributing to a more holistic approach to business management.

Prior to his current role at WeWork, Daniel honed his analytical skills as a Financial Analyst at Brandish LLC. Here, he was pivotal in developing financial models and performing comprehensive market analysis to support investment decisions.

Before joining Brandish LLC, Daniel gained valuable experience as a Summer Analyst at Gramercy Funds Management LLC, where he was immersed in the fundamentals of asset management and investment strategies. His early career also included a stint as a Legal Consultant at Costello Shea & Gaffney LLP, where he assisted legal teams with financial assessments and compliance matters, showcasing his versatility and understanding of the intersection between finance and law.

Education and Achievements

Daniel’s academic journey began at the prestigious Cornell University, where he earned a Bachelor of Science (BS) degree in Labor and Industrial Relations with a specialization in Business. His time at Cornell not only equipped him with foundational knowledge in industrial relations but also fostered critical thinking and problem-solving skills that he would later apply in the finance sector. The combination of an in-depth understanding of labor dynamics and business operations has set Daniel apart as an influential figure in his field.

Before his collegiate achievements, Daniel attended Regis High School, a highly respected institution known for its rigorous academic curriculum and emphasis on formative learning experiences. His time there laid the groundwork for his future success and ambition.
